
Liverpool are preparing to launch a stunning summer raid for Newcastle United's star striker Alexander Isak, with the Reds identifying the Swedish international as their primary attacking target.
The Merseyside giants are ready to test Newcastle's resolve with a substantial offer that could approach the £100 million mark, potentially making Isak one of the most expensive signings in the club's history.
Newcastle's Financial Dilemma
Newcastle find themselves in a precarious financial position despite their Saudi-backed ownership. The Magpies must comply with Premier League Profit and Sustainability Rules (PSR), forcing them to consider selling key assets.
Isak has emerged as the most likely candidate to be sacrificed, with the 24-year-old's value having skyrocketed since his £63 million arrival from Real Sociedad in 2022.
Isak's Stellar Season
The Swedish forward has been in electrifying form this campaign, netting 21 goals across all competitions despite Newcastle's inconsistent performances. His pace, technical ability and clinical finishing have made him one of the most feared strikers in the Premier League.
Isak's performances have not gone unnoticed, with several top European clubs monitoring his situation, but Liverpool appear to have moved to the front of the queue.
Liverpool's New Era
With Jurgen Klopp departing at season's end, Liverpool's new sporting structure led by Michael Edwards and incoming sporting director Richard Hughes are determined to make a statement signing.
The acquisition of Isak would represent a major coup for Klopp's successor and signal Liverpool's intent to challenge Manchester City for domestic supremacy next season.
Newcastle fans will be desperate to keep their talismanic striker, but the financial realities of modern football may force the club's hand in what promises to be one of the summer's biggest transfer sagas.
